How to Have More Self Esteem in Your Life
Jul 21st, 2009 by admin

Having more self-esteem can help your personal and professional life improve. Additional confidence and self-assurance can take you far. Your inner thoughts and beliefs can stand in your way as you try to develop a confident persona.


Problems with Confidence


Being confident is a very admirable characteristic that is welcoming and assuring. Those who lack this characteristic may seem untrustworthy or weak. When you have problems with confidence, it can stem into other areas of your life.


You may be like many people who feel that their own confidence is an unsavory characteristic. It is necessary to make a distinction between arrogance. Confident tendencies are energetic and positive. Arrogance is defeating.


A person with more self-esteem is confident. This quality seeks to work with others and to help bring the best out in those around you. Arrogance is belittling and assuming. Confident behavior is not arrogant because it is beneficial.


Perception and Value


You are a deserving individual who has something unique to offer. This may be difficult for you to see if you have a deprecating core belief system that works against you. Your perception of who you are is a very important aspect of your success in gaining assurance and confidence.


It takes practice to see your own value and worth when you have a negative perception of yourself. It is necessary to change the way you see yourself as you develop more value for who you are.


Using Self-Hypnosis to Get More Self-Esteem


Your perception of who you are has been in development for your entire life. You have thought processes that focus on certain aspects and it is important to take an objective inventory of your core beliefs about yourself. This can help you see how realistic you are and which areas need to be addressed.


Hypnosis can help you develop positive thoughts about yourself while removing the negative thoughts. Instead of focusing on your faults, you begin to recognize your strengths. You also learn to be less critical of your actions.


Your inner critic can be helpful but it can also be your worst enemy. Hypnosis works to balance the critical voice with an affirming one. The focus isn’t on your mistakes and things that you can’t control. It is on what you can do and what you do well.


Enjoy the process rather than focusing on perfection. Hypnosis helps you get over the urge to be perfect. You develop a practice of seeing mistakes as sources of learning and growth and you genuinely feel good about yourself.


Your core beliefs about yourself can stand in your way unless you work through the subconscious mind. You can foster a new, healthy belief system that is positive and assuring. Hypnosis is a wonderful approach to develop more self-esteem.

How to Build Lasting Self-Confidence
Jul 19th, 2009 by admin

Self-confidence is having the belief in our ability to do or accomplish something, or to succeed. It largely involves our past learning experiences, successes, and achievements.


For many of us self-confidence can fluctuate up and down, depending on the daily challenges we face in comparison with our ability to deal with those challenges. However, building a sustainable and balanced self-confidence is achievable. What follows are some ways to do just that.


First and foremost, building a lasting self-confidence requires a degree of focus and the determination to follow through toward real and solid achievements. There is no quick way to acquire self-confidence. It requires work because that’s what success requires, and it is success in our endeavors that breeds self-confidence. Thus, the more successes you have the more lasting your self-confidence will be.


Secondly, to build upon the self-confidence that you already have take an inventory and recall your past successes. Bring to mind the feeling you had at the moment of each of those successes. Experience those successes in your mind again and then apply that experience to the current challenge you might be facing.


Many athletes perform this very mental exercise prior to every competition they participate in. Some call it “psyching the self up”. But it’s that recalled feeling that help these competitors build the lasting self-confidence to be successful in each and every competition.


Goal setting is also important to establishing lasting self-confidence. Often we successfully accomplish a task and reap the rewarding feeling of self-confidence, only to have our self-confidence dissipate over time. This is because we didn’t set other goals after completing the previous one.


If you want to have lasting self-confidence then you need to ontinuously set goals before yourself and accomplish them each and every time, one after the other. Moreover, by setting goals and accomplishing them you put structure into your life. Structure can help in establishing a lasting self-confidence.


Confident self talk is another way to build lasting
self-confidence. Let yourself know you are capable of accomplishing your goals. Tell yourself that you will effectively execute the strategies necessary to reach your goal.


If necessary think the strategies through, envisioning yourself in the execution of each and every step. This is called visualization and it will influence your self-confidence.


Our thoughts, feelings, and behaviors are all inter-related. Whenever you act confidently it will help increase your
self-confidence. This is especially important to do when your self-confidence begins to diminish, which at times happens to even the best.


To act confidently keep your head up, put a bounce in your step, and focus on those things you can control. Even when things don’t seem so good, this behavior can activate thoughts of self-confidence.


To maintain a lasting self-confidence it is very important to have and focus on achievable goals. If your goals are
realistically beyond your immediate reach you may be setting yourself up for a failure and failure, although it is part of the learning process, may not help you to establish lasting self-confidence.


Instead, set goals for yourself that are challenging, but ones that you know you can reach and successfully accomplish with a bit of hard work and determination.


Self-confidence comes not just from the accomplishment of our goals, but more from the knowledge of the hard work we invested into accomplishing them. Almost every true soldier knows that it’s not just the winning of the battle that makes a soldier, but more importantly it’s the battle itself that makes a soldier a soldier.


Yes, soldiers do reflect upon the glory of victory, but they reflect more upon the sweat, blood, and tears that made the victory possible. Lasting self-confidence is developed through the same principle.

How to Build Confidence by Understanding What it is – And What it Isn’t
Jul 16th, 2009 by admin

I used to feel quite concerned when my clients asked me how they could build their confidence. As a Personal Coach I was clear what they wanted – but I knew the concept of ‘confidence’ was intangible. Only after years of helping and supporting people did I realise what this request was really about.


There are numerous powerful techniques around today to help people build confidence. One of them – Neuro Linguistic Programming (NLP) – has produced a great variety of tools, most of which are designed to help people feel unstoppable, energised and invincible.


Sometimes these feelings are appropriate to a situation and sometimes they’re not the right sort of confidence required. For example, if a loved one needs emergency brain surgery and the surgeon who is going to perform it is bouncing off the walls with energy and absolutely 100% confident, you might not feel happy about entrusting your loved-ones life to them if you discovered they were only a junior doctor!


In this article I invite you to further explore what being confident means to YOU.


I shall start with some simple questions:


- Are you confident that you can clean your teeth or do you need to use techniques to feel unstoppable before picking up your toothbrush and toothpaste? I suggest you just go to the bathroom and brush your teeth, not giving it a second thought! I think it’s probably safe to say that you’re confident you can clean your teeth.
- What about switching on the light in your living room, or getting yourself dressed in the morning – even driving to work? These too are things you know you can do and feel confident about – right?
- Have you noticed how people talk about confidence? While they will commonly tell you they’re confident about doing this, or that, they mostly use the word confidence in connection with a lack of it! For example, they say “I don’t have the confidence to do that” or “I wish I felt more confident when talking with people of the opposite sex” or “I can’t speak in public because I’m not confident.”


We’re now moving closer to my realization of what confidence is, and what it’s not.


The things you know you can do (such as cleaning your teeth) don’t have feelings associated with them. They’re things you just do. The feeling only comes when you lack of confidence.


It’s a lack of confidence that we have to deal with – not confidence itself – and lack of confidence is nothing more than a way of saying we’re afraid or concerned. Just think for a moment about something you feel unconfident about. Do you fear that you might not be able to do that thing?
What you’re fearful of is what the outcome might be.


You’re probably familiar with the principle that says that when you’ve finally defined what the problem is, you’re most of the way to solving it! People who seek confidence are actually seeking something that probably doesn’t exist. For the majority of people the word confidence just means a lack of fear.


This now makes it much easier to deal with.


These days when I work with people to help them build confidence, I get them to identify the precise fears or concerns they have. With each individual client those fears or concern are different. Sometimes they’re imagined; sometimes it’s about a lack of knowledge; often it’s because they currently lack the skills to do what they want.


Let me give you an example. A client who wants to gain confidence in talking with the opposite sex is fairly common. When they first approach me, what’s probably going on inside their head is a combination of fear of rejection, fear of being laughed at, fear of failure etc.


Now let’s imagine the same person if they’d had thousands of conversations with people of the opposite sex. Since they’d had the experience of being flexible and relaxed in conversations, how do you think they’d feel? Is it likely they’d already have the confidence they’re looking for?


So if you apply the same principle to things that you feel a lack of confidence about, identifying your concerns and your fears, what skills or abilities, if you had them, would mean that most of them would disappear? What if you already had experience in this type of situation, how would you feel then?


Maybe the way for you to get the confidence you’re looking for is to identify ways to develop your skills and to gain knowledge
